| 520 | _aA new report from the National Audit Office "The UK emissions trading scheme: a new way to combat climate change", claims the UK emissions trading scheme has been successful in reducing the discharge of greenhouse gases. The scheme was launched in March 2002 by DEFRA to allow participants to buy and sell allowances to emit greenhouse gases, such as carbon dioxide. In its first year the 31 participants received incentive payments which reduced the total emissions by almost six times the target for the year.
